Available free zones

Oman free zones

Oman / Dhofar

Salalah Free Zone

Oman Indian Ocean free zone for logistics, manufacturing, food, chemicals, and re-export.

Cost
Project and facility-based
Visas
Depends on lease and manpower plan
Setup
3 to 8 weeks

Oman / Al Batinah North

Sohar Free Zone

Oman port-linked free zone for logistics, petrochemicals, metals, food, and manufacturing.

Cost
Project and facility-based
Visas
Depends on facility and manpower plan
Setup
3 to 8 weeks

Oman / Al Wusta

Duqm SEZ

Large-scale Oman SEZ for industrial, maritime, logistics, tourism, and energy projects.

Cost
Project-based
Visas
Depends on project and manpower plan
Setup
4 to 12+ weeks

Oman / Dhofar

Al Mazunah Free Zone

Oman-Yemen border free zone for trading, logistics, light industry, and re-export.

Cost
Facility-based
Visas
Depends on lease and workforce plan
Setup
3 to 8 weeks

Oman / Al Batinah South

Khazaen Economic City

Oman integrated logistics and economic city near Muscat.

Cost
Project and facility-based
Visas
Depends on facility and activity
Setup
3 to 8 weeks
